    Having only taken 3 papers, F4,6 and P1, I find F6 hardest unless you’re well prepared in the tax laws of your variant especially the corporate taxes which has a connection with the individual taxes.
    P1 you need to read pyp to understand how they approach the questions and a basic read on some of the ethical theories, the rest are basically internal controls and risks which are basically on the spot and it’s according to the case study, so just pick out all the anomalies and give a reasonable resolution to it.
    As for F4, I prepared entirely by studying KAPLAN notes from my friend, and I can say as long as you nail the MCQ, it’s hard to fail.
